
XPO GLOBAL FORWARDING NANTES
XPO GLOBAL FORWARDING FRANCE is a recognized provider of end-to-end supply chain solutions with a multi-station network across France. The company integrates intercontinental Ocean and Air Freight with value-added logistics services and comprehensive supply chain management. An Authorized Economic Operator (AEO) certification and an ISO 9001:2015-compliant Quality Management System underscore its commitment to quality and regulatory standards. The organization emphasizes staff training in good distribution practices and IATA/IMDG regulations for dangerous goods, aligning operations with industry best practices.
The Nantes presence is part of a broader French footprint that includes hubs and stations at major airports and ports, with explicit references to locations such as Lille, Nantes, Strasbourg, Lyon, Toulouse, and Marseille. This network supports diverse sectors, including Aviation & Aerospace, Chemicals, Automotive, Consumer Goods & Retail, Fashion, Pharma and Healthcare, Industry & Engineering, Luxury Goods, Perfumes & Cosmetics, and other specialized fields. The company communicates a capability for handling both intercontinental shipments and domestic logistics within France, enabling end-to-end services from origin to destination.
Air freight operations are highlighted through trained and certified personnel in dangerous goods handling and good distribution practices, with access to contracted airline rates and a fully integrated transportation management system (TMS) based on Cargowise One. The listed services for air freight include direct service, daily consolidation, door-to-door delivery, palletization, orders management, quality control, packaging, full or partial charters, dangerous goods management, temperature-controlled handling for perishables, out-of-gauge cargo management, and time-critical solutions such as On Board Carry (OBC) and aircraft on ground (AOG) support.
Ocean freight operations are described as supported by a network of offices dedicated to seafreight handling, including NVOCC status and chemicals expertise with a proprietary fleet of isotank containers. The service portfolio for ocean includes full container loads (FCL) and less-than-container loads with consolidation (LCL), break-bulk, customs brokerage, and specialized isotank services (MEGC, TOP ONLY, small capacity, and container fleet management).
The company also offers dedicated road freight services to Ukraine, Russia, CIS, and other former Soviet states, aided by multilingual stations and staff for European routes. Services under road freight cover full truckload and less-than-truckload options between major European cities and consolidated trucking to Ukraine, Belarus, Russia, Kaliningrad, and surrounding states.
